3rd confirmation this works with Trudograd but I had to do the following to get it to work edit: Copy 0Harmony12.dll from the Unity Mod Manager folder to this directory: Steam\steamapps\common\ATOM RPG Trudograd\Mods\NoWeight\ (this solution was posted by HozzMidnight a posts up)
I have steam version and I get this error from UMM:
?[NoWeight] [Error] Error loading file 'D:\Program Files (x86)\Steam\steamapps\common\ATOM RPG Trudograd\Mods\NoWeight\NoWeight.dll'. [NoWeight] [Exception] FileNotFoundException - Could not load file or assembly '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null' or one of its dependencies. System.IO.FileNotFoundException: Could not load file or assembly '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null' or one of its dependencies. File name: '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null' at (wrapper managed-to-native) System.MonoCustomAttrs.GetCustomAttributesInternal(System.Reflection.ICustomAttributeProvider,System.Type,bool) at System.MonoCustomAttrs.GetCustomAttributesBase (System.Reflection.ICustomAttributeProvider obj, System.Type attributeType, System.Boolean inheritedOnly) [0x00013] in <695d1cc93cca45069c528c15c9fdd749>:0 at System.MonoCustomAttrs.GetCustomAttributes (System.Reflection.ICustomAttributeProvider obj, System.Type attributeType, System.Boolean inherit) [0x00037] in <695d1cc93cca45069c528c15c9fdd749>:0 at System.RuntimeType.GetCustomAttributes (System.Type attributeType, System.Boolean inherit) [0x00038] in <695d1cc93cca45069c528c15c9fdd749>:0 at UnityModManagerNet.UnityModManager+ModEntry.Load () [0x004c8] in <98d5daeb090c4be2b7e2984fa16ce767>:0
The path in the error is correct and all of the mod files are there.
Установка: 1. Запустить UnityModManager.exe от имени Администратора 2. В первой вкладке выбрать в директории Game - ATOM RPG, вFolder - папку с игрой 3. Во вкладке Mods нажать Install Mod и показать путь к zip-файлу мода 4. Назад на первую вкладку и Update 5. В папке UnityModManagerInstaller появится подпапка с названием игры и zip архивом внутри 6. Копируем эту папку в Mods корневого директория игры 7. Вы прекрасны!
Good day! Can you please tell me if there is any other mod - manager with which your mod works, besides UnityModManager? I'm trying to get your mod and "Neutron" to work, but it has its own "0Harmony.dll" file and is incompatible with the "0Harmony.dll" from the "UMM" manager. As a result, either you have to give up something, or find a way to combine. Or another mod manager, without "0Harmony".
I'm not a programming expert and it might be silly, but I tried to copy the 0Harmony.dll file from the "UMM" folder to the "... AppData \ LocalLow \ AtomTeam \ Atom \ Mods" folder. And vice versa. It did not help.
It is working. Just choose as Game "Atom RPG", as Folder "...\steamapps\common\ATOM RPG" after starting "UnityModManager.exe. Switch to tab "Mods" and drop NoWeight.zip there. It will unpack the files to "...\steamapps\common\ATOM RPG\Mods\NoWeight" (... maybe you have to do it twice if there will apear no folder with the files or choose "Install Mod" instead and point to the NoWeight.zip.
Now after you start the game UnityModManager will start an show you the "NoWeight" Mod activated.
(And according to Neutron Readme you do not have to activate 0Harmony for Neutron to work.)
Seams it only works on GOG version. On Steam one after installing UMM with the assembly option my carry weight goes up to 56k but as soon as i want to move i get message my character is encumbered and cannot move. I can move again after dropping every item in my inv on the ground, but as soon as I pick up over 5kg of items back from the ground same thing happens again.
you have to click assembly in the UMM and select the folder that the game is installed to. find the zip of the mod and install it. if you get a notepad popup saying injection failed, just add the atomrpg.dll to the folder. took me a minute of tinkering with it and it worked. im at 80000kg now :)
28 comments
EDIT: just tried and it works with Trudograd too. :)
Steam\steamapps\common\ATOM RPG Trudograd\Mods\NoWeight\ (this solution was posted by HozzMidnight a posts up)
\Program Files (x86)\Steam\steamapps\common\ATOM RPG Trudograd\Mods\NoWeight\
I have steam version and I get this error from UMM:
?[NoWeight] [Error] Error loading file 'D:\Program Files (x86)\Steam\steamapps\common\ATOM RPG Trudograd\Mods\NoWeight\NoWeight.dll'.
[NoWeight] [Exception] FileNotFoundException - Could not load file or assembly '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null' or one of its dependencies.
System.IO.FileNotFoundException: Could not load file or assembly '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null' or one of its dependencies.
File name: '0Harmony12, Version=1.2.0.1, Culture=neutral, PublicKeyToken=null'
at (wrapper managed-to-native) System.MonoCustomAttrs.GetCustomAttributesInternal(System.Reflection.ICustomAttributeProvider,System.Type,bool)
at System.MonoCustomAttrs.GetCustomAttributesBase (System.Reflection.ICustomAttributeProvider obj, System.Type attributeType, System.Boolean inheritedOnly) [0x00013] in <695d1cc93cca45069c528c15c9fdd749>:0
at System.MonoCustomAttrs.GetCustomAttributes (System.Reflection.ICustomAttributeProvider obj, System.Type attributeType, System.Boolean inherit) [0x00037] in <695d1cc93cca45069c528c15c9fdd749>:0
at System.RuntimeType.GetCustomAttributes (System.Type attributeType, System.Boolean inherit) [0x00038] in <695d1cc93cca45069c528c15c9fdd749>:0
at UnityModManagerNet.UnityModManager+ModEntry.Load () [0x004c8] in <98d5daeb090c4be2b7e2984fa16ce767>:0
The path in the error is correct and all of the mod files are there.
1. Запустить UnityModManager.exe от имени Администратора
2. В первой вкладке выбрать в директории Game - ATOM RPG, вFolder - папку с игрой
3. Во вкладке Mods нажать Install Mod и показать путь к zip-файлу мода
4. Назад на первую вкладку и Update
5. В папке UnityModManagerInstaller появится подпапка с названием игры и zip архивом внутри
6. Копируем эту папку в Mods корневого директория игры
7. Вы прекрасны!
Can you please tell me if there is any other mod - manager with which your mod works, besides UnityModManager?
I'm trying to get your mod and "Neutron" to work, but it has its own
"0Harmony.dll" file and is incompatible with the "0Harmony.dll" from the
"UMM" manager. As a result, either you have to give up something, or
find a way to combine. Or another mod manager, without "0Harmony".
I'm not a programming expert and it might be silly, but I tried to copy the
0Harmony.dll file from the "UMM" folder to the "... AppData \ LocalLow \
AtomTeam \ Atom \ Mods" folder. And vice versa. It did not help.
I need to try with a different mod manager.
Just choose as Game "Atom RPG", as Folder "...\steamapps\common\ATOM RPG" after starting "UnityModManager.exe.
Switch to tab "Mods" and drop NoWeight.zip there.
It will unpack the files to "...\steamapps\common\ATOM RPG\Mods\NoWeight" (... maybe you have to do it twice if there will apear no folder with the files or choose "Install Mod" instead and point to the NoWeight.zip.
Now after you start the game UnityModManager will start an show you the "NoWeight" Mod activated.
(And according to Neutron Readme you do not have to activate 0Harmony for Neutron to work.)
Thanks for your mod.